Step-by-Step Guide to Installing the Battery
Follow these steps to install the battery in your Alcatel flip phone with ease.
Preparing the Phone
Start by turning off your Alcatel flip phone if it’s still on. Locate the back cover, usually marked with a small notch for opening. Use a plastic opening tool to gently pry off the back cover. Set it aside in a safe place to avoid losing it during the process.
Removing the Old Battery
Identify the old battery in the phone’s compartment. Carefully lift the battery from the edge using your fingers or tweezers. If it feels stuck, wiggle it slightly to loosen it. Once removed, dispose of the old battery properly, following your local e-waste guidelines.
Installing the New Battery
Take your new battery and align it correctly in the compartment. The positive terminal should match the positive contact point inside the phone, usually indicated by a “+” symbol. Press down firmly until the battery clicks into place, ensuring a secure fit.
Closing the Phone
Align the back cover with the phone and press down firmly until it snaps back into place. Check that the cover sits flush with the phone’s body. Turn the phone back on and verify that it powers up correctly. Your Alcatel flip phone is now ready for use with the new battery.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Sometimes, issues may arise after installing a new battery in your Alcatel flip phone. Here are common problems and their solutions.
Battery Not Charging
If your newly installed battery is not charging, follow these steps:
- Check the Charger: Ensure you’re using the original charger. Use a different wall outlet if the current one isn’t working.
- Inspect the Cable: Look for any visible damage on the charging cable. A frayed or broken cable might prevent charging.
- Clean Charging Port: Dust and debris can clog the charging port. Use a soft brush or compressed air to clean it gently.
- Leave It for a While: Sometimes, it takes time to start charging. Let your phone sit connected to the charger for at least 15 minutes before testing.
Loose Battery Fit
If the battery feels loose or doesn’t fit snugly, try these steps:
- Remove and Reinsert: Take out the battery and check for any dirt or debris on the contacts. Reinsert the battery, ensuring it clicks into place.
- Check Battery Orientation: Make sure the battery terminals align correctly with the phone’s connectors. Incorrect alignment can cause a poor fit.
- Inspect the Battery Compartment: Look for any damage or warping in the battery compartment. Any irregularities may affect how the battery sits.
- Use Battery Tape: If the battery continues to feel loose, consider using double-sided tape to secure it temporarily until the issue is resolved.
Following these troubleshooting tips can help resolve common issues after installing the battery in your Alcatel flip phone.
